CORPORATE SOCIAL RESPONSIBILITY

A discussion with examples from the Pulp and Paper industry

Our Country Manager in China, Ms. Petrel Qiu, issued a publication on the corporate social responsibility (CSR) of the Pulp and Paper industry, in collaboration with Dr. Dieu Hack-Polay, the International Business School Suzhou at Xi'an Jiaotong Liverpool University, (close to Shanghai). This paper points out the advantages of a good CSR policy concerning economy, environment and social aspects. ABSTRACT
 
Corporate social responsibility (CSR) involves multi-faceted concerns and interested parties. The theoretical paper argues that pursuing CSR policies creates value for sustainable economic prosperity for the pulp and paper sector. The pulp and paper industry is one of the largest industrial sectors worldwide and plays a critical role in global development. As the fourth largest energy user and CO2 emitter, the industry is subject to the vicissitudes of global society and environment. Irresponsible pulp and paper operations are now shunned by various stakeholders, which ultimately affect their economic bottom lines. Sustainable operations bring continuity and competitiveness along with innovation, efficiency and social recognition to the industry. Using the criteria of the triple-bottom-line theory (economic, environmental and social), this paper demonstrates that a strong CSR framework and proactive initiatives add value to the pulp and paper business.
